Dram Shop/Liquor Liability Wrongful Death: A bar continued to serve alcohol to an intoxicated individual known to have an alcohol addiction. The individual left the bar and walked into the street in front of traffic. He was hit and killed by a vehicle. A confidential settlement was reached.

Wrongful Death: A passenger was ejected from a vehicle being driven by a wanted fugitive while fleeing from police. The passenger was unaware that the driver was wanted by police. The passenger died at the scene of the accident. The case was settled for the driver's insurance policy limits despite the driver's insurance company's initial argument that the accident was not covered by insurance, since the driver was in the course of committing a criminal act that was specifically excluded from coverage under the driver's insurance policy.

Wrongful Death: An elderly couple was hit head-on by another vehicle. The husband died at the scene of the accident. The wife sustained serious injuries including a broken pelvis. The case settled for the policy limits of both the at-fault driver's insurance coverage and the elderly couple's underinsured motorist coverage with their own insurance company.
